In this work we have studied the dispersion of the disorder-induced (D) and the second-order (G') Raman bands in single wall carbon nanotubes using several laser excitation energies (E laser) in the range 1.5-3.0 eV. An anomalous step-like behavior was observed in the E laser dependence of the G'-band frequency. This result is interpreted as a manifestation of the one-dimensional (1D) behavior of the phonon spectrum in carbon nanotubes. |
